vue数组对象排序的实现代码

前端之家收集整理的这篇文章主要介绍了vue数组对象排序的实现代码前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。

前言

最近在看vue的教学视频,正好学到的数组对象排序方法,在这跟大家分享一下,如有不足之处,请赐教。

普通数组的排序

先看代码

v-for实例
v-for实例

数组对象的排序

如果数组项是对象,我们需要根据数组项的某个属性对数组进行排序,要怎么办呢?其实和前面的比较函数也差不多。所以我就只把部分代码分享出来了。

如何对这个数组进行age排序呢

比较函数

y)?1:0)); }) }

这里我是用三元函数来判断的,也和下面这个代码效果一样

val2) { return 1; } else { return 0; } } }

我觉得这个代码有点冗杂,所以我就用了三元运算符来判断输出

结果:

整个项目文件

<Meta charset="UTF-8"> <Meta name="viewport" content="width=device-width,initial-scale=1.0"> <Meta http-equiv="X-UA-Compatible" content="ie=edge"> v-for

结果:

文章对新手有用,也希望你们能和我一起分享知识,一起成长。也希望大家多多支持编程之家。

原文链接:https://www.f2er.com/vue/31845.html

猜你在找的Vue相关文章